Navigating Culinary Tradition and Colonial Influence

This chapter examines the clash between traditional and post-Columbus ingredients in North American cuisine, focusing on fry bread's significance to Navajo culture. It also highlights the Miss Navajo pageant's shift towards embracing a broader range of traditional dishes in cultural celebrations.
